The Public Education Technician will report to the Staff Coordinator. Public Education Technicians are primarily responsible for assisting with the department’s Community Risk Reduction & Safety Programs including Smoke Detector Battery Changes and Smoke Detector installation, Child Safety Seat installations; CPR, AED, First Aid & Fire Extinguisher instruction; Community AED Program support and District facilities AED checks. The Public Education Technician will perform all Emergency reporting functions for the recording of all public requests for safety assistance and education. They may also assist and provide needed support to other Public Safety personnel as required. Public Education Technicians exhibit a friendly and caring attitude when interacting with residents to ensure positive community relations.
